How to Install a Plugin
There are many plugins available for WordPress sites, and it can be difficult to decide which one to install. Here are some tips for choosing plugins:
1. Research the plugin before downloading it. Look at the reviews and ratings, and read the description to find out what the plugin does.
2. Check whether the plugin is compatible with your WordPress site. Some plugins require certain versions of WordPress or other plugins to work properly, so make sure the plugin you’re installing is compatible.
3. Decide whether you need the plugin and whether it’s worth spending money on it. Someplugins offer features that may be useful for your site, but others may not be worth the price.
4. Install a plugin only if you’re sure that you need it and that it will improve your site’s functionality. If you’re not sure, wait until you have a chance to test it out before installing it.
